QUALIFICATION, REQUIREMENTS, AND/OR EXPERIENCE

The following duties ARE NOT intended to serve as a comprehensive list of all duties performed by all employees in this position, only a representative summary of the primary duties and responsibilities. Employee may not be required to perform all duties listed and may be required to perform additional, position-specific duties.

  • Must be able to pass internal Forklift test and certification program and remain in compliance.
  • Designated Forklift Trainer – will train and test selected staff in safe Forklift operation.
  • General maintenance and repair of buildings, facilities, equipment, and grounds including carpentry, electrical, plumbing, glazier, masonry, and painting tasks, etc.
  • Repair and treat structures such as floors, showers, sinks, walls, roofs, and carpets; performs minor troubleshooting, repairs, and adjustments of locks on doors, cabinets, desks, closets; repairs door hinges.
  • Changes filters on heating, ventilating and air conditioning units and air compressors.
  • Services appliances, kitchen, and emergency equipment; hooks up appliances; reports mechanical malfunctions to appropriate party for action.
  • Moves and assists in moving furniture and equipment at various facilities/sites; sets up and breaks down cubicle partitions.
  • Exercises discretion in identifying projects requiring the services of a higher skilled crafts person.
  • Assists in obtaining quotes and arranging for services of outside vendors as needed.
  • Annotates and updates work logs for specific site requirements.
  • Activates and deactivates building alarms and responds to alarm calls during and after regular work hours.
  • Ability to learn manufacturing safety practices.
  • Maintains clean, safe, and orderly work sites.
  • Be able to communicate issues related to work.
  • Maintain cleanliness of shop and office work areas, including lunchroom, break, and restroom maintenance.
  • Full-time attendance is required.
  • Other duties as directed.
